UTZ Quality Foods Inc Part Time Warehouse Utility in Leetsdale, Pennsylvania

Reference #: 5001073464800 Utz Quality Foods is looking for a dependable individual to join our team as a Part Time Warehouse Utility associate to maintain accurate warehouse inventories, ensure proper product rotation, and pull, sort, and prepare product orders for sales professionals as required. This position will be based in our Leetsdale, PA Sales Center, and is generally scheduled for approximately 28 hours per week. Key Responsibilities Open/Close the distribution center facility as required. Unload trailers that arrive at the center and check trailer loads for inventory accuracy. Rotate warehouse inventory to maintain longest product shelf-life. Pull product to fill extra orders as requested by salespeople. Responsible to determine warehouse product needs daily. Pull product to fill daily orders submitted by route salespeople. Responsible to maintain accurate daily inventory balances. Use a hand-held computer to balance the daily inventory (warehouse inventory, daily orders, extra orders, return to stock, trailer loads). Responsible to accept and check return to stock product and stale and damaged products. Place returned cardboard and stale and damaged product on trailers. Perform various maintenance duties as required (cleaning, mowing, etc.). Job Requirements Organization and attention to details to maintain accurate inventory records and rotation of product at the distribution center. Basic math and writing skills necessary to track, count, and record information. Requires independent decision making on inventory needs, especially during promotional activity. Requires an ability to communicate through speech, vision and hearing. Must be able and eligible to safely operate and maintain required equipment to fulfill warehousing responsibilities. Ability to obtain a DOT certification. Must be at least 19 years of age. Requires a valid driver's license. Must be able to operate a route sales delivery step van in a safe and competent manner. Requires proper lifting techniques with an ability to lift, carry, and transport products.
